About New Bedford Time Zone
New Bedford, United States uses America/New_York, which is the IANA timezone name for the Eastern Time zone in the northeastern United States. The city follows UTC-5 during standard time and UTC-4 during daylight saving time, so the clock shifts seasonally rather than staying fixed year-round.
Daylight saving time is observed in New Bedford, United States, and the 2026 schedule follows the Eastern Time pattern used across Massachusetts and much of the U.S. East Coast. On Sunday, March 8, 2026, clocks go forward 1 hour from UTC-5 to UTC-4, and on Sunday, November 1, 2026, clocks go back 1 hour from UTC-4 to UTC-5. That matters for anyone coordinating with Boston-area offices, New York financial markets, or Atlantic-facing shipping and service operations that depend on precise local timing.
Because New Bedford, United States is in the same Eastern Time region as much of the Northeast, it aligns closely with major business centers such as New York and Boston for much of the workday. It also sits one hour ahead of Central Time and several hours behind Europe and Asia depending on the season, which makes early-morning East Coast meetings especially important for transatlantic teams and late-afternoon coordination more practical for Asia-Pacific partners.

Time Differences from New Bedford
In January, New Bedford, United States (UTC-5) is 5 hours behind London (UTC+0): when it is 9:00 AM in New Bedford, it is 2:00 PM in London. In July, New Bedford, United States (UTC-4) is 5 hours behind London (UTC+1): when it is 9:00 AM in New Bedford, it is 2:00 PM in London. This makes London a workable same-day partner for late-morning calls in New Bedford, especially for finance, trade, and customer support teams.
In January, New Bedford, United States (UTC-5) is 14 hours behind Tokyo (UTC+9): when it is 9:00 AM in New Bedford, it is 11:00 PM in Tokyo. In July, New Bedford, United States (UTC-4) is 13 hours behind Tokyo (UTC+9): when it is 9:00 AM in New Bedford, it is 10:00 PM in Tokyo. That gap usually pushes New Bedford–Tokyo coordination into early morning in Massachusetts or late evening in Japan.
In January, New Bedford, United States (UTC-5) is 16 hours behind Sydney (UTC+11): when it is 9:00 AM in New Bedford, it is 1:00 AM the next day in Sydney. In July, New Bedford, United States (UTC-4) is 14 hours behind Sydney (UTC+10): when it is 9:00 AM in New Bedford, it is 11:00 PM in Sydney. For teams spanning the U.S. East Coast and Australia, this usually means one side must take an early or late slot to avoid after-hours meetings.
In January, New Bedford, United States (UTC-5) is 9 hours behind Dubai (UTC+4): when it is 9:00 AM in New Bedford, it is 6:00 PM in Dubai. In July, New Bedford, United States (UTC-4) is 8 hours behind Dubai (UTC+4): when it is 9:00 AM in New Bedford, it is 5:00 PM in Dubai. That overlap is useful for import/export coordination, logistics updates, and vendor calls that need to land near the end of the Dubai business day.
